rf waves in electrodynamic plasma acceleration

In a study of the rf instability in the frequency range 0.5--10 GHz in a plasma accelerator with an external magnetic field, the conditions correpsonding to instability and to microwave generation at a level above the thermal level are determined from the intensity of the electromagnetic component of the rf field. Intense microwave generation occurs under extreme operating conditions of the plasma accelerator. The microwave intensity is 2--3 orders of magnitude above the thermal level. Microwave generation is accompanied by an increase in the ion velocity in the plasma stream while the other discharge parameters remain constant. (AIP)
